Not all chatbots are created equal, especially when it comes to Retrieval‑Augmented Generation (RAG) – the technology that lets a bot pull precise information from a knowledge base in real time. For plumbing companies, RAG means instant, accurate answers about pipe sizes, repair procedures, or warranty terms, all without a human operator. Drift is a conversational marketing platform that blends live chat, AI chatbots, and automated lead qualification into a single experience. The platform is designed for sales teams and marketing departments that want to engage website visitors in real time, qualify leads, and schedule meetings with minimal friction. Drift’s AI chat feature uses natural language processing to answer common product questions, but the technology is not explicitly RAG‑based; it relies on pre‑defined intents and knowledge snippets. The bot can be configured via a visual builder, and it integrates with major CRMs such as Salesforce, HubSpot, and Pipedrive. Drift is well‑suited for plumbing companies that need to capture leads for scheduled service appointments or estimate requests. Key features include AI‑powered chat that can answer FAQs, automatic conversation routing to sales reps, and scheduling tools that sync with Google Calendar. The platform also offers marketing automation, email workflows, and detailed analytics dashboards. Drift’s pricing begins at $600/month for the Starter plan, which includes core chatbot and live chat features. Higher tiers add additional seats, advanced personalization, and deeper integrations. Intercom is a customer messaging platform that offers live chat, AI chatbots, and a knowledge base to provide real‑time support and engagement. While Intercom’s chatbots are not explicitly RAG, they do pull information from a connected knowledge base to answer common questions. The platform allows users to create a self‑service help center, integrate with e‑commerce data, and automate repetitive tasks using bots. Intercom’s visual builder lets marketers set up conversational flows without coding. Key features include live chat, bot automation, product tours, in‑app messaging, and a knowledge base that can be queried by the bot. The platform also offers robust analytics, A/B testing, and integration with popular CRMs and email services. Intercom’s pricing structure is tiered: the Essential plan starts at $39/month, the Pro plan at $99/month, and the Premium plan at $199/month. Ada is an AI‑powered customer service platform that focuses on automating repetitive support tasks. The platform uses machine learning to understand customer intents and can answer FAQs or route conversations to human agents when needed. Ada’s knowledge base is document‑based and can be updated via a web interface, but it does not use a true RAG architecture. Ada excels at multilingual support and can be deployed across web chat, Facebook Messenger, and SMS. Key features include a visual bot builder, multilingual support, integration with popular CRMs (Salesforce, Zendesk), real‑time analytics, and a self‑service knowledge base. Ada’s pricing is quote‑based, with plans tailored to the size of the organization and the volume of conversations. ManyChat is a conversational marketing platform primarily geared toward Facebook Messenger, Instagram Direct, SMS, and WhatsApp. The platform offers a drag‑and‑drop visual builder that allows marketers to create automated flows, broadcast messages, and set up chatbots to answer FAQs. ManyChat’s bot logic is rule‑based, not RAG, but it can pull information from a connected knowledge base or external sources via webhooks. Key features include broadcast messaging, automated flows, lead generation forms, integration with Shopify and WordPress, and basic analytics. ManyChat offers a free tier with limited features, a Pro tier at $10/month, and a Growth tier at $30/month.
